Police are investigating after a number of people on a street in Dundee received a chilling letter claiming they were under 24 hour surveillance by a sordid blackmailer.

The malicious mail was sent to homes on Charleston Drive at the end of the January leaving the victims feeling ‘intimidated’.

The rambling writer claims to have “hundreds of hours” of CCTV footage from inside properties on the street - including films of residents in their bedrooms.
